11 Editorial Staffers Laid Off in Nielsen Magazine Reorg; 19 Jobs Cut In Total

imageAs part of the reorg of its Adweek Media Group, B2B publisher Nielsen Business Media has laid off 11 staffers in editorial, paidContent has learned. A Nielsen rep confirmed the cuts, which come on top of the 8 additional posts eliminated in some of the travel, performance group and retail food group publications, which were announced yesterday, for a total of 19 cuts at the company. Most of those cut were reporters, not editors, at the group’s pubs Adweek (which lost 3 staffers), Mediaweek (4 down), Brandweek (3 cut) and Editor & Publisher (1 lay off).  Nielsen is putting together a new content strategy for its 40 magazine properties, which also include The Hollywood Reporter, and Billboard, as well as the aforementioned titles. At the Adweek Group, the three separate editorial teams will now be combined into one, though the individual titles will remain.
